First Grades From PSA, 1985 Topps Football

Just got my PSA club free grades back. Ouch. I busted a 1985 Topps football wax box and took the 5 best looking cards out as well as a Warren Moon card, which I didn't think was as high quality as the others. As you can see, it seems to have made no difference. I also have 25 others I felt were the best quality cards from the wax box. I may submit 3 others (Marino, Payton, passing leaders) but since I didn't get any 9's or 10's, I won't be submitting a lot of these again. Cheaper to buy already graded 9's on ebay.

I feel your pain. I have opened up recently wax packs, rack packs, grocery rack packs, cellos, and a vending box. Out of all that I found one card worth turning in and that was a Marcus Allen. It came out of the vending box and although it did come back a 10 I still won't get all the money back that I put in. I would stick to buying already graded cards for this very frustrating set, but if you decide to buy more packs stay away from the grocery racks and cellos. Corners are always f'd up.
